- (Edited by S.C Cockerell.., Ornamental initial capitals from designs by William Morris. Printed in black, with chapter titles, side notes and colophon in red. Golden type on Batchelor handmade paper, watermarked: Perch., Limited ed. of 225 paper copies (30s.) and 8 vellum copies (5 gns.), issued 6th Jan. 1898. Imprint from colophon, dated 15th Dec. 1897., Pp. 1-23 printed on one side of the leaf only., "All the blocks (with one exception) were prepared by Walker and Boutall under the direction of the late William Morris." - Colophon., "Of the 35 reproductions of German woodcuts here given, 29 are all that were done of a series chosen by William Morris to appear in the Catalogue of his library, which was to have been annotated by him and printed at the Kelmscott Press. The other 6 were made for his article in the 4th no. of Bibliographica on the Early Woodcut books of Ulm & Augsburg." - Foreword.)
